@awholeian

The success stories may be less, but MS has a similar program for the Xbox 360 with the Indie games service.

Membership costs are about the same, as is cuts for each piece of software sold. The main difference is that games on the Xbox 360 are reviewed by fellow developers instead of Microsoft, which means that games are released more quickly. So there are other options.

This has nothing do with piracy as all the games involved are licenced from their respected copyright holder. This is all about program code, or user-generated program code.

Apple sells it's SDK for $99. This SDK enables people to write code for the platform. If you have applications which enables user-generated code which costs far less, that has the potential to stop people buying the SDK. It doesn't matter if the BASIC emulator is limited, it's a blanket ban on all kinds of these features to stop loopholes appearing in the terms Apple lays out to developers.
